An example to retract the arrows to make room for the saddlebags.
I bought the kit from Webike
https://www.japan-webike.it/products/23661336.html
In order not to see the cables I pierced the headlight support (photo 1 - 1a)
Remove all sheaths and lengthen the arrow cables (photo 2)
Insert all the cables in a thermo retractable (photo 3)
Attention, mark the two cables of an arrow (photo 4)
Make the new connections (photo 5)
All cables in the thermo retractable (photo 6)
Pass the cable through its housings (photo 7)
Done! (photo 8)
